BROCCOLI CHICKEN MAC AND CHEESE
This Broccoli Chicken Mac and Cheese recipe is made with a delicious cheddar-Parmesan cheesy sauce, and kicked up a notch with fresh broccoli and cooked chicken.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Cook pasta al dente** in a large stockpot of generously-salted water, according to package instructions. About 2-3 minutes before the pasta reaches al dente, add in the broccoli florets and let them cook alongside the pasta for the remainder of the cooking time. Drain and set aside.
- Meanwhile, as the pasta water is heating, melt butter in a (separate) medium saute pan over medium-high heat. Add garlic and saute for 1 minute or until fragrant, stirring occasionally. Whisk in the flour until combined and cook for an additional 1 minute, whisking occasionally. Slowly whisk in vegetable or chicken stock until the mixture is smooth. Then slowly whisk in the milk until it is combined. Continue cooking for 1-2 minutes, or until the mixture comes to a simmer. Then remove from heat, and stir in the cheddar, Parmesan, salt and pepper until the cheese sauce is smooth. Remove from heat.
- Once the pasta and broccoli are cooked, pour the cheese sauce on top of the pasta, add in the chicken, and toss until everything is evenly combined.
- At this point, you can either serve the pasta stovetop-style as-is. Or pour the pasta into a greased 9 x 13-inch baking dish, and sprinkle with extra cheddar cheese and Panko breadcrumbs.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the top becomes slightly crispy and the breadcrumbs are slightly golden. Remove and serve immediately.
- *To cook the chicken breasts on the stove top, he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a large saute pan. Pound chicken to even thickness, and sprinkle both sides with a few generous pinches of salt and pepper. Add to the pan and cook for 3-4 minutes per side,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ink inside. (Cooking times will vary depending on the thickness of your chicken.) Or, to bake the chicken breasts in the oven, follow these instructions.
- **If making the baked version of this dish, I recommend ever-so-slightly undercooking your pasta, as it will cook a bit more while it bakes in the oven.

CHICKEN AND BROCCOLI MACARONI AND CHEESE
Mix Cheddar, Pecorino-Romano and Parmesan for an extra-cheesy chicken mac and cheese.

Steps:
-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the macaroni and broccoli and cook for 5 minutes; the pasta will only be about halfway cooked. Reserve 1 cup of the cooking water, then drain the pasta and broccoli and return them to the pot.
- Meanwhile, sprinkle the chicken with salt and pepper. Heat 1 tablespoon of the but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ook, stirring occasionally, until browned and cooked through, 5 to 7 minutes; set aside.
- Put the pot with the pasta and broccoli over low heat. Stir in the milk, flour, mustard, Worcestershire, 1 teaspoon salt and the remaining 1 tablespoon butter. Bring to a simmer and cook, stirring, until the sauce thickens and the pasta is al dente, 3 to 5 minutes. Turn off the heat, add the Cheddar, Pecorino-Romano, Parmesan, cooked chicken and 1/4 cup of the reserved cooking water and stir until the cheese melts. Gradually add the remaining cooking water as needed until the pasta is creamy and saucy. Serve hot.
GARLIC CHICKEN & BROCCOLI
This simple riff on Chinese chicken proves you can savor the takeout taste you crave while still eating right. -Connie Krupp, Racine, Wisconsin

Steps:
- In a 4- or 5-qt. slow cooker, combine chicken, broccoli, carrots, water chestnuts and garlic. In a large bowl, mix next 7 ingredients; pour over chicken mixture. Cook, covered, on low until chicken and broccoli are tender, 3-4 hours., Remove chicken and vegetables; keep warm. Strain cooking juices into a small saucepan; skim fat. Bring juices to a boil. In a small bowl, mix cornstarch and water until smooth; stir into cooking juices. Return to a boil; cook and stir until thickened, 1-2 minutes. Serve with chicken, vegetables and hot cooked rice., Freeze option: Place chicken and vegetables in freezer containers; top with sauce. Cool and freeze.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Microwave, covered, on high in a microwave-safe dish until heated through, stirring gently; add broth or water if necessary.

CREAMY GARLIC CHICKEN
Serve up creamy garlic chicken with fluffy mashed potato and spinach for a comforting family dinner. This simple and satisfying recipe is the perfect midweek meal

Steps:
- Cook the potatoes in boiling salted water for 20-25 mins until tender when pierced with a knife. Meanwhile, heat the 2 tbsp Flora Buttery in a frying pan over a medium heat until melted, then fry the onion for 10 mins until softened. Stir in the garlic, fry for a minute more, then add the chicken and fry for 5 mins until lightly golden.
- Pour in the wine, bring to a simmer and reduce until halved. Stir in 250ml of the crème fraîche. Cook for 5 mins until the chicken is cooked through, and the sauce has thickened slightly.
- Drain the potatoes, leave to steam dry for 1 min, then mash with the 50g Flora Buttery, remaining crème fraîche and some seasoning, until smooth. Stir the herbs and spinach through the chicken and cook for a minute or so until the spinach wilts. Add the lemon juice and some seasoning. Serve spooned over the creamy mash.
